Output 90a735df61dd1e9cc9292cb899534de41d0f98a3e7e1b9eb78dfbfdb1741b922:2

value
2186266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720b754122ddf9ef98370bdc14a9188ed0f9338f OP_EQUAL
address
3C62gXh4NFhuCrfD7HGU6TLCnoE8W28kJn
transaction
90a735df61dd1e9cc9292cb899534de41d0f98a3e7e1b9eb78dfbfdb1741b922
spent
true